In this case, the leafing worked to my advantage. Here’s how you make your own spray-painted gourds...it’s super easy.

 

You will need:



    • Gold spray paint

 

    • Silver spray paint

 

    • Drop cloth



Then:



    1. Spread all the gourds out on the drop cloth. I split the quantity in half, putting gold at one end of the cloth and silver at the other.

 

    1. Starting with the underside of each gourd, spray the surface of each gourd lightly, going back and forth a few times.

 

    1. Let them dry for 1-2 hours.

 

    1. When completely dry, turn them right side up and spray the top and side surfaces.

 

    1. Again, let them dry and then decorate as desired.
